32#ifndef __SPARC_PROCESS_HH__
33#define __SPARC_PROCESS_HH__
34
35#include <string>
36#include <vector>
37#include "sim/byteswap.hh"
38#include "sim/process.hh"
39
40class ObjectFile;
41class System;
42
43class SparcLiveProcess : public LiveProcess
44{
45  protected:
46
47    const Addr StackBias;
48
49    //The locations of the fill and spill handlers
50    Addr fillStart, spillStart;
51
52    SparcLiveProcess(LiveProcessParams * params,
53            ObjectFile *objFile, Addr _StackBias);
54
55    void startup();
56
57    template<class IntType>
58    void argsInit(int pageSize);
59
60  public:
61
62    //Handles traps which request services from the operating system
63    virtual void handleTrap(int trapNum, ThreadContext *tc);
64
65    Addr readFillStart()
66    { return fillStart; }
67
68    Addr readSpillStart()
69    { return spillStart; }
70
71    virtual void flushWindows(ThreadContext *tc) = 0;
72};
73
74template<class IntType>
75struct M5_auxv_t
76{
77    IntType a_type;
78    union {
79        IntType a_val;
80        IntType a_ptr;
81        IntType a_fcn;
82    };
83
84    M5_auxv_t()
85    {}
86
87    M5_auxv_t(IntType type, IntType val)
88    {
89        a_type = SparcISA::htog(type);
90        a_val = SparcISA::htog(val);
91    }
92};
93
94class Sparc32LiveProcess : public SparcLiveProcess
95{
96  protected:
97
98    Sparc32LiveProcess(LiveProcessParams * params, ObjectFile *objFile) :
99            SparcLiveProcess(params, objFile, 0)
100    {
101        // Set up stack. On SPARC Linux, stack goes from the top of memory
102        // downward, less the hole for the kernel address space.
103        stack_base = (Addr)0xf0000000ULL;
104
105        // Set up region for mmaps.
106        mmap_start = mmap_end = 0x70000000;
107    }
108
109    void startup();
110
111  public:
112
113    void argsInit(int intSize, int pageSize);
114
115    void flushWindows(ThreadContext *tc);
116};
117
118class Sparc64LiveProcess : public SparcLiveProcess
119{
120  protected:
121
122    Sparc64LiveProcess(LiveProcessParams * params, ObjectFile *objFile) :
123            SparcLiveProcess(params, objFile, 2047)
124    {
125        // Set up stack. On SPARC Linux, stack goes from the top of memory
126        // downward, less the hole for the kernel address space.
127        stack_base = (Addr)0x80000000000ULL;
128
129        // Set up region for mmaps.  Tru64 seems to start just above 0 and
130        // grow up from there.
131        mmap_start = mmap_end = 0xfffff80000000000ULL;
132    }
133
134    void startup();
135
136  public:
137
138    void argsInit(int intSize, int pageSize);
139
140    void flushWindows(ThreadContext *tc);
141};
142
143#endif // __SPARC_PROCESS_HH__
